lanterne des Morts de Cormery
Cormery's lantern of the dead is a monument located in the Cormery cemetery in Indre-et-Loire, France. While this monument, probably of the twelfth century, is commonly referred to as "the lantern of the dead", certain architectural features, such as the full structure of its column, bring it closer to a hosanary cross whose top, mutilated, would have lost its distinctive attributes. Unique in Indre-et-Loire, the lantern of the dead was classified as historical monuments in 1920.
